一般描述

本品为包含3,3′,5,5′-四甲基联苯胺(TMB)的弱酸性缓冲液。底物以单组分即用型溶液提供。速率动力学约比传统TMB配方快40%。不推荐用于需要沉淀反应产物的膜或免疫组化应用。

应用

3,3′,5,5′-四甲基联苯胺(TMB)是适用于ELISA程序的过氧化物酶底物。底物产生可溶的浅蓝色最终产物,并且可以在370或655nm下通过分光光度计读取。可以用2M H2SO4停止TMB反应(产生黄色溶液),并在450nm处读取数值。
的3,3′,5,5′-四甲基联苯胺是超灵敏的ELISA液体底物,可用以下应用的作过氧化物酶底物:
  • 通过转染子测定合成的透明质酸和HAS2(透明质酸合成酶)表达
  • 测定结合的α-溶血素毒素的水平
  • 结合IgG成像
